[0022] According to FIG. 1, the seat panel 1, preferably made of wood, is fixedly connected via screw connections 4 to a support plate 7, which forms the upper bearing of a slide bearing via a dome-shaped inversion. lining. A thin foamed plastic sheet 2 glued to the seat panel 1 covers the carrier plate 7 and serves as a soft, non-slip seat surface. A gap 8 is provided in the middle of the seat plate, so that the dome of the support plate 7 rests on a hemispherical plastic part 5 pressed into the support pin, and the connected seat plate 1 can be tilted in all directions at least + / -20°. In order to keep the wear in this bearing low and nevertheless to achieve the required stability, steel is chosen as the material for the support pin 6 and has a diameter of 14 mm. The support pin 6 is fixedly connected to a height-adjustable post 14 by means of adhesive, clamping pin 15 or bolts. Abstract

The invention relates to a dynamic seat arrangement comprising a seat plate (1) supported by means of a bearing head (5) on the bottom of a support (14) with adjustable height stand or rest on a support surface. In order to ensure the user's automatic and natural movement while being free to move, the invention provides that the seat panel (1) has a gap (8) arranged in its center that expands from its top surface towards its bottom surface. ), a bearing bush (19) passes through the gap (8) in the seat plate (1) from below and is fixed, and the bearing bush (19) is placed on the bearing head (5) of a support pin (6), wherein the bearing The head (5) is spherical or hemispherical, thus creating a common point of rotation and pivot above the seat plate (1).

technical field [0001] The invention relates to a dynamic seat arrangement comprising a seat plate which is supported tiltably and rotatably by means of a bearing head on a base frame with a height-adjustable column or on a support surface. Background technique [0002] A book by the author group SVSS is entitled "The Seat as a Burden (Sitzen als Belastung)" (Verlag pmsi Holdings Deutschland GmbH, Publisher, 1993, recommended by the German Seating Association (Bundesverband der deutschen Rückenschulene.V.)). The book's 200 pages explain that the correct seat is not a rigid fixture, but requires continuous mobility. Since these unrestricted movements cannot be achieved while sitting in an ordinary chair, it is suggested in the book that one must consciously alternate between various sitting positions.
